← ScienceWhich consequence result when electrons exceed a tunnel diode's valley voltage?
A)Increased quantum tunneling probability
B)Negative differential resistance region ends✓
C)Reduced electron-phonon scattering rate
D)Avalanche breakdown becomes dominant
💡 Explanation
The negative differential resistance diminishes because higher voltage reduces the **quantum tunneling** effect. Therefore, current begins to increase with voltage rather than decrease, while other effects don't dominate.
